Feeder Cattle Narrative Report for Monday 06/16/2014


Actual Receipts: 7428   Last Monday: 6234   Year Ago Monday: 9274


Compared to last week: Feeder steers sold mostly 6.00 to 10.00 higher,
with instances of 10.00 to 15.00 higher on steers weighing over 800 lbs.
Feeder heifers mostly 4.00 to 6.00 higher. Steer calves 8.00 to 10.00
higher, light weight calves sharply higher but were lightly tested. Heifer
calves 10.00 to 14.00 higher, with instances of up to 17.00 higher on 550-
600 lb heifers. Demand very good for all classes.

The CME Feeder Cattle Index continued to march upward late last week and closed higher this
afternoon with the fall contracts reported to be staying around 208.00-
209.00 range. The strength on the CME board has supported the higher
prices reported in the barn. Temperatures are forecasted to remain in the
90s for the rest of the week, with a slight chance of thunderstorms
mid-week. Receipts this week totaled 70 percent over 600 lbs and 38
percent heifers.
